Transaction 2c154058077f987e19dc06a35b721e6cde4a9a3dddeda95e12f9ce48f636f61a

1 Input
2 Outputs
  • 2c154058077f987e19dc06a35b721e6cde4a9a3dddeda95e12f9ce48f636f61a:0
  • value  62358014008
    address  2MviDcAGvzD6CAWG3UMLqiQsRzy8bzjLLfB
  • 2c154058077f987e19dc06a35b721e6cde4a9a3dddeda95e12f9ce48f636f61a:1
  • value  18670904
    address  2Mx54gxgJzJwPgCNQ51BnMU1fyY1hVoBhmc